Prayer Unto Life

When I pray, it is often: “May I be free from this suffering, from this need!” “Let this cup pass from me!” Matt. 26:39. But my prayer needs to be more clear: Jesus prayed—He even prayed before His greatest trial, and added: “Nevertheless, not as I will, but as You will.”

I also want to learn to pray in this way. Not as someone who wants to get out of it, but as someone who wants to learn obedience through what he suffers. “But for this purpose I came to this hour.” John 12:27.

“But seek first the kingdom of God and His righteousness, and all these things shall be added to you.” Matt. 6:33. I seek deliverance, but do I have eyes to see what God wants to give me? I have already received what I prayed for, only in a better way. Mark 11:24.

Do I allow earthly things to be tools in God’s hands, or do I seek them as an escape from the tribulations?
